    Sridhar Rangayan is a critically acclaimed film director, screenwriter, producer and activist. He is also a controversial figure in his home country of India, mainly as a result of his sexuality. To mark World Aids Day, he will be in DCU today to show his film, '68 Pages', a film about HIV in India and he came in to talk to Pat this morning.

    Saturday 1st December marks the 24th anniversary of World AIDS Day, when individuals and organisations from around the world come together to bring attention to the disease. Della Kilroy has been taking a look at some of the progress that has been made both nationally and internationally.
